About Legacy Community Health
- A Federally Qualified Health Center (FQHC) committed to high-quality, inclusive health care
- Embark on a mission to enhance patient lives through comprehensive care services
- Began in 1981 as the Montrose Clinic, evolving into a leader in healthcare delivery with multiple locations
- Offers a wide range of services spanning from primary care to specialized fields like HIV/AIDS care and behavioral health
- Dedicated to education and preventive measures within the community
Key Responsibilities
- Conduct patient counseling to support safe and effective medication use
- Perform detailed drug utilization reviews to avert potential drug-drug and drug-disease interactions
- Identify and address duplicative therapies, enhancing treatment protocols
- Improve medication adherence across diverse patient ages and needs
Qualifications
- Enrollment in an accredited college or university of pharmacy
- Certification in immunization delivery
- Valid pharmacist intern license from the Board of Pharmacy of the State of Texas
- Maintain Basic Life Support (BLS) Certificate
